Amy Schumer slams Met Gala

Amy Schumer has slammed the Met Gala.
The 35-year-old comedian attended the Metropolitan Museum of Art’s Costume Institute Gala in May this year but insisted it was her first and last time because she hated every minute of it.
Speaking to Howard Stern on his Sirius XM show, she said: "It’s people doing an impression of having a conversation. …I don’t like the farce. We’re dressed up like a bunch of f**king a**holes. I don’t like it. I have no interest in fashion. …I don’t care."
"I got to meet Beyoncé and she was like, ‘Is this your first Met Gala?’ And I was like, ‘It’s my last.’"
Meanwhile, Amy is currently living with furniture designer Ben Hanisch and says he is completely different from her previous boyfriends.
Speaking to ‘Entertainment Tonight’, she said: "I usually would go for narcissists who, you know, could never be happy. [Ben’s] just very supportive and loving and I think we’re very proud of each other. He is so far removed from this business that it’s really nice."
However, the blonde beauty hasn’t always felt like this as she admitted just last month that she was constantly worried that the hunk would call time on their relationship.
She said at the time: "Being in love is the scariest thing in the world. You want to f***ing cry and scream. I can’t handle it. Every time we say goodbye, I think, ‘This will have been a nice last week together.’ Or I tell myself nothing is real and he’s going to leave me and tell me he never loved me. I feel so bad for him. How exhausting it must be dating me."
